Validace složených dokumentů XML

Název práce: Compound XML documents
Autor(ka) práce: Nálevka, Petr
Typ práce: Diploma thesis
Vedoucí práce: Kosek, Jiří;xx0025270;Práce z oboru výpočetní techniky.
Oponenti práce: Nič, Miloslav
Jazyk práce: English
Abstrakt:
Klíčová slova:
Název práce: Validace složených dokumentů XML
Autor(ka) práce: Nálevka, Petr
Typ práce: Diplomová práce
Vedoucí práce: Kosek, Jiří;xx0025270;Práce z oboru výpočetní techniky.
Oponenti práce: Nič, Miloslav
Jazyk práce: English
Abstrakt:
Tato práce se zabývá různými charakteristikami komponovaných dokumentů a ukazuje potencionální výhody využití takových dokumentů v prostředí dnešního Webu. Hlavní pozornost je soustředěna na problémy spojené s validací komponovaných dokumentů. Práce zkoumá různé přístupy k řešení těchto problémů. Validační metoda NVDL (Namespace-based Validation Dispatching Language) je popsána detailně. Tato práce popisuje hlavní principy NVDL, zkoumá výhody a nevýhody oproti jiným přístupům a představuje JNVDL. JNVDL je kompletní implementace specifikace NVDL, která byla napsána v jazyce Java jako součást této práce. Popsány jsou nejen technické prvky implementace, ale JNVDL je představeno i z uživatelské perspektivy. Pro ověření využitelnosti bylo JNVDL integrováno do existujícího projektu pro validaci webových dokumentů s názvem Relaxed, aby jednoduše zpřístupnilo validaci komponovaných dokumentů autorům webového obsahu.
Klíčová slova: validace;NVDL;Relax NG;Namespaces;XML;HTML;JNVDL;Relaxed

Informace o studiu

Studijní program / obor: Aplikovaná informatika/Informační a znalostní inženýrství
Typ studijního programu: Magisterský studijní program
Přidělovaná hodnost: Ing.
Instituce přidělující hodnost: Vysoká škola ekonomická v Praze
Fakulta: Fakulta informatiky a statistiky
Katedra: Katedra informačního a znalostního inženýrství

Informace o odevzdání a obhajobě

Datum zadání práce: -
Datum podání práce: -
Datum obhajoby: 13. 6. 2007
Identifikátor v systému InSIS:

Soubory ke stažení

    Poslední aktualizace: